MICROSOFT DESKTOP DEAL RILES GOVERNMENT OFFICIALS IN THE NETHERLANDS
The Dutch government announced plans to adopt Microsoft software for
245,000 desktop PCs. In doing so, it has angered officials who
believed the government would hold true on its promise to go open
source.
